簡述ospf的工作原理_現代數字存儲示波器的工作原理簡述

95da0e537ee00894460e7459b3b24497.png

示波器是一種用途十分廣泛的電子測量儀器。俗話說,電是看不見摸不著的。但是示波器可以幫我們“看見”電信號,便于人們研究各種電現象的變化過程。所以示波器的核心功能,就和他的名字一樣,是顯示電信號波形的儀器,以供工程師查找定位問題或評估系統性能等等。

而波形,也有多種定義,比如時域或者頻域的波形,對于示波器而言,大多數時候測量的是電壓隨時間的變化,也就是時域的波形。因此,示波器可以分析被測點電壓變化情況,從而被廣泛的應用于各個電子行業及領域中。

一般我們業內對示波器的分類只按模擬示波器和數字示波器來分,有些廠家可能為了突出其示波器的某項功能給其命名為其他名字,比如數字熒光示波器等。但其本質原理依然逃不出這2大示波器類別。

模擬示波器是屬于早期的示波器,主要基于陰極射線管(也叫顯像管,曾廣泛應用于早期的電視機、顯示器)打出的電子束通過水平偏轉和垂直偏轉系統,打在屏幕的熒光物質上顯示波形。

1e551aac13d2681352b9852fb18a8450.png

然而到了現在,模擬示波器所剩下的優點,似乎就只有價格了。它沒有存儲數據和分析波形能力,觸發功能也有限,捕獲單次和偶發信號的能力也不行,而且由于其內部采用了大量模擬器件,隨著時間溫度變化這些器件也會發生變化,因此性能也不穩定。現代電子測量中幾乎已經淘汰了模擬示波器,因此我們今天主要講的也是數字示波器。

早期的數字示波器,由于顯示技術制約,使用的依然是模擬示波器上的CRT(Cathode Ray Tube,陰極射線管)顯示屏。數字示波器區別于模擬示波器的最大不同,主要在于輸入的信號不再直接打到顯示屏上,而是通過ADC(Analog to Digital Converter,模數轉換器)對信號采樣和數字化處理后存入高速緩存里,再通過信號處理電路將數據讀出來。

由于早期的數字示波器用CRT顯示,因此還需要通過DAC數模轉換器把數字量轉換成模擬量顯示到CRT顯示屏上。現代化的數字示波器,也已經大多不再使用CRT顯示屏,而是采用液晶顯示屏,不但體積減少很多,有些還提供了更加操作便捷的觸控功能,而且也不再需要把數字化的采樣點轉換成模擬信號了。由于這兩者在功能結構上沒有本質區別,所以業界一般也沒有CRT示波器和LCD示波器的叫法。

fbb54736c01e3f8c34374ef8e6a22c72.png

數字示波器很多時候都被叫做數字存儲示波器,因為數字示波器中重要的一環,就是把ADC采集的數據存儲起來。現代數字示波器采集數據的主要過程我們通過這塊麥科信STO1104C智能示波器的主板進行直觀了解:

3f4158743b569233dbb90a80278e411b.png

①信號通過探頭衰減成合適比例送入示波器前端。示波器能測多大電壓一般取決于探頭,探頭通過衰減可以把上萬伏的電壓信號變成幾十伏。

②信號通過耦合電路到達前端衰減器和放大器,示波器軟件上表現為調節垂直檔位,使得波形盡量占滿整個屏幕,從而提高垂直精度,使測量更準確。前端部分很大程度上決定了示波器的第一指標:帶寬。

e0bff2924d807f9287f6ee22480c82d9.png

③ARM處理器控制FPGA調節ADC模數轉換器采樣率,示波器軟件上表現為調節時基,由于存儲深度為固定值,采樣率 = 存儲深度 ÷ 波形記錄時長,通常時基設置的改變是通過改變采樣率來實現的。因此廠家標注的采樣率往往是在特定時基設置之下才有效的,在大時基下受存儲深度的影響,采樣率不得不降低。ADC模數轉換器和RAM高速存儲器影響著示波器的另外兩大指標:采樣率和存儲深度。

④接下去,由FPGA驅動ADC同步采樣,ADC將采集到的數據進行二進制數據化并寫入高速緩存。存儲器緩存即存儲深度,一般存儲器的大小是示波器標識存儲深度大小的四倍,因為FPGA無法控制示波器的觸發,因此采集的信號必定先是標識存儲深度的2倍,然后再來根據觸發篩選其中的一段波形,所以示波器可以看到觸發位置之前的波形。又由于示波器在篩選之前采集的波形的時候,采集不能停,否則就會導致波形捕獲率太低,因此同時還需要繼續采集同樣長度的采樣點,如此反復,這樣一來就是四倍了。

5207b68ec3c54af857696b7f3a14e5e9.png

⑤收到觸發指令后,存儲器再把數據交給ARM處理器處理

⑥ARM處理器將數據處理后通過顯示接口將數據輸出至顯示屏展示給使用者。通過計算,示波器還能模仿出類似模擬示波器的多級輝度顯示,以及數字示波器特有的色溫顯示效果,余暉顯示效果。

⑦示波器處理完數據后,可以把當前的波形圖像或者是數據保存到存儲器中,要注意這里的存儲完全不同于存儲深度的高速存緩,大多數示波器采用外部存儲器如U盤,SD卡,電腦等,現在一些現代化的示波器會內置大存儲可以直接保存在示波器里。

這個過程中,②③④都是并行處理的。

由于數字示波器處理速度的制約,所以它并不能保證被測信號的波形能連續不斷地實時顯示在屏幕上,顯示的兩個波形之間會有波形數據丟失,也即所說的死區時間,這也是數字示波器相比較于模擬示波器的最大缺點了。不過,隨著示波器運算能力的增強,波形捕獲率的不斷上升,這一缺點也在被慢慢彌補。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/533909.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/533909.shtml
英文地址,請注明出處:http://en.pswp.cn/news/533909.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

pyecharts 間距_高月雙色球20108期:紅球首尾間距參考29區段

雙色球第2020108期獎號為:03 09 11 24 25 28 16,紅球和值:100,重號2個:11 28,首尾間距:25。和值:上期和值為100,上升了22點,再次開出小和值,最近…

java類中聲明log對象_用于Android環境,java環境的log打印,可打印任何類型數據

LogXixi用于Android環境,java環境的log打印,可打印任何類型數據,根據android項目環境debug環境自動打開,release環境自動關閉android環境log打印,規范bean對象,json,xml對應log,crash捕捉&#…

xbox手柄接收器驅動_xbox手柄連接 win10電腦

xbox手柄 連接win10筆記本 分為三種連接方式:有線藍牙無線適配器首先說明一下連接方式的特點然后說明連接方式第一種:有線連接 手柄直接通過micro USB數據線和win10電腦連接。這一步最簡單,一般電腦會自動安裝驅動,連接之后可以使…

單片機復位后為什么要對sp重新賦值_51單片機系列之2點亮第一個led小燈

點亮led燈簡單的理解就是要求陽極高電平陰極低電平。接下來我們去看看單片機的原理圖,找到led 模塊。如圖可以看到led的陽極是連接的VCC(電源高電平)陰極連接的接口是單片機的I/O口P20到P27.要想led點亮只需控制單片機I/O口輸出低電平即可(單片機I/O口默認高電平)。…

db2與mysql編目_DB2編目、聯邦數據庫 - Goopand's OS Space - OSCHINA - 中文開源技術交流社區...

一、兩個數據庫在不同的服務器上[環境描述]10.0.0.10:庫名為 db_1010.0.0.17:庫名為 db_17[需求描述]在db_17庫中,跨庫查詢db_10庫的表[操作步驟]1)在10.0.0.17數據庫服務器,開啟聯邦支持db2 "update dbm cfg using federate…

關機時無人照管更新正在運行_無法抗拒的未來:無人叉車在內部物流中已成為現實...

自動化和半自動化的叉車不再是新奇的東西,在人力短缺的倉庫中取得了進展。他們最終會成為規范嗎?目前尚不知道全世界有多少輛無人駕駛叉車(也稱為自動叉車、機器人叉車或者AGV)售出。但是叉車生產商都顯示出,它在該領域的迅速增長。重要的是&#xff0c…

打開瀏覽器不是主頁_對于360瀏覽器的一些小小改善

?雖然自己不怎么喜歡,但是以前小編的多數同事都在使用它,所以今天帶來360安全瀏覽器改造的小建議。整理&排版 | idea君 ,預計閱讀 | 4分鐘文章意在學習交流分享,如有侵權請聯系刪除封面:http://www.pexels.com/zh…

c++ 二次開發 良田高拍儀_六枝特良田LYV-850加工中心導軌配套防護罩日常維修

六枝特良田LYV-850加工中心導軌配套防護罩日常維修我廠生產的防護罩質量可與原廠的一樣,同樣的保障,質保期為一年,護罩安裝不合適支持退換貨。尤其是元件連結的接合面剛度,對加工精度影響較大。通常,采用組合夾具時其尺…

atomikosdatasourcebean mysql_SpringBoot2整合JTA組件實現多數據源事務管理

一、JTA組件簡介1、JTA基本概念JTA即Java-Transaction-API,JTA允許應用程序執行分布式事務處理,即在兩個或多個網絡計算機資源上訪問并且更新數據。JDBC驅動程序對JTA的支持極大地增強了數據訪問能力。XA協議是數據庫層面的一套分布式事務管理的規范,JTA…

crt 8.7.3 黑暗模式_民謠纏繞厄運金屬,抒情中的黑暗故事

2020/7/31,瑞典厄運/重金屬樂隊Dun Ringill,發表了新專輯“Library of Death”。“Library Of Death”是瑞典樂隊Dun Ringill的第二張唱片,由The Order of Israfel、Doomdogs等成員發起。樂隊的聲音,介于重金屬和厄運金屬之間&…

前窗玻璃膜貼了一周還有氣泡_關于車窗玻璃的養護你了解多少?

【中國皮卡網 維修保養】車窗玻璃的養護是最容易忽視的,但它也是非常重要的,雖然在用車過程中我們很少直接接觸車窗玻璃,但是它卻時時刻刻在影響著駕駛者。相信很多人會有洗車的習慣,洗好之后的車窗玻璃非常明亮,不僅僅…

c語言新龜兔賽跑_幽默 | 新龜兔賽跑

新龜兔賽跑作者 / 何必加自從輸給了烏龜后,兔子心里很是生氣。這一天,他又遇見了烏龜,要求和他比賽,一定要一雪前恥。烏龜答應了,并且約定連比三場。第一場還是兔子輸了,原來他一著急,跑錯了方向…

PHP無法執行MySQL語句,解決PHP執行批量MySQL語句的問題

這篇文章主要為大家詳細介紹了解決PHP執行批量MySQL語句的問題,具有一定的參考價值,可以用來參考一下。感興趣的小伙伴,下面一起跟隨512筆記的小玲來看看吧!當有多條mysql語句連起來需要執行,比如$sqls “insert table…

bugku 雜項 就五層你能解開嗎_長春老舊小區加裝電梯,你家符合條件嗎?_媒體_澎湃新聞...

新朋友戳藍字關注我們哦!長春市老舊小區開始加裝外置電梯大家都很關注很多市民也在想我家符合加裝條件嗎?能申請嗎?伴隨著長春市朝陽區3個老舊小區加裝電梯工作的結束,這項惠民工程也成為了老百姓茶余飯后的談資,那么大…

vba 指定列后插入列_Excle中的VBA介紹分享

SunYoung1、什么是VBAVisual Basic for Applications(VBA)是Visual Basic的一種 宏 語言,它能使常用的程序自動化,是針對Office開發的一種工具,通俗點講,VBA是一種Excle能聽懂識別的編程語言。2、在Excle中VBA的作用2.1、實現Exce…

php中文歌詞,html如何制作滾動歌詞

html制作滾動歌詞的方法:首先在標簽里面寫好編碼格式,引入css樣式和jQuery;然后放置播放器,代碼為【】。本教程操作環境:windows7系統、html5版,DELL G3電腦。html制作滾動歌詞的方法:首先我們創…

docker run 服務名_在 WSL2.0 的 Ubuntu 18 里使用 Docker

近日,隨著Windows 10 2004版本的發布,WSL 2經過了近一年的insider測試,現在也正式上線了。Windows 10 2004中引入了一個真實的Linux kernel,使得系統全部的系統調用更加兼容。這也是首次,Linux kernel安裝在Windows系統…

vb.net如何查詢電腦麥克風收到聲音_EMUI 10.1 跨屏協同實測:這一次把你的手機「搬」進電腦...

智能手機發展到現在,我們越來越需要手機與其他設備進行互聯互通。電腦是我們辦公最常用的工具,手機則是生活必需設備,這兩者的協同需求,自然也就成為了大多數用戶的痛點。Apple 用隔空投送、接力、隨航等連續互通功能來打造系統生…

浮動導航欄php源碼,JQuery 浮動導航欄實現代碼

JQuery 浮動導航欄/* 浮動導航欄 Begin */#floatMenu{padding-top: 5px;background: url(http://img.jb51.net/images/quickmenu.gif) no-repeat;border: 1px solid #dcdcdc;position: absolute;top: 250px;left: 5px;margin-left: 0px;width: 86px;}#floatMenu ul{margin-left…

gerber文件怎么導貼片坐標_SMT貼片工序

貼片,也稱SMT,就是把元器件用貼片機設備貼裝在印刷好的PCB板上。貼片這一過程之所以用“貼”字,是因為錫膏內有助焊劑的成分,有一定的粘性,能夠在沒有熔化的時候,也能夠黏住元器件。SMT又稱貼片&#xff0c…